The video tutorial explains how to solve an equation to find the value of x. It begins by identifying the operations applied to x, such as multiplication and addition, and then explains the need to reverse these operations. The tutorial highlights the importance of taking the square root to undo squaring and considers both positive and negative roots. Finally, it demonstrates solving for x by isolating it and verifying the solutions.
